Naltrexone blocks the reward effects of alcohol and opioids
Naltrexone is used to treat alcohol and opioid dependence, blocking opioid receptors in the brain, reducing cravings, and preventing the euphoric effects of alcohol or opioids. It is nonaddictive and works best as part of a comprehensive treatment plan, including counseling or therapy, to support long-term recovery.
